Output 84a21872503810462338ab00b3d4fed6f8241aca35b916ff594af62e901ed48f:4

value
425487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9cbe15d7a3f2b67b7bff34abb282f87c254f756 OP_EQUAL
address
3MYco2Pi3yE7aQ7fn3pLpMWquzSBKxsFC1
transaction
84a21872503810462338ab00b3d4fed6f8241aca35b916ff594af62e901ed48f
spent
true